Stop S Evade SPACE Attack 1 RMB Attack 2 W Secret Skill MB3 Defend MB4 Heal F Use \ Interact E Reload R Open Pack TAB Next Target MW-Up Prev Target MW-Dn _______________________________________________________________________________ 4.THINGS TO KNOW {TTK1} 4.1.COMBAT {CMB1} In BASTION you will have access to many weapons, all of which have a primary fire, some have secondary fire and secret skill attacks. Each weapon has several upgrades which can be obtained from exploring the world / winning different challenges. Each weapon has a different method of usage and each is useful in different circumstances- don't be afraid to try different weapons at different times. Evade / roll is also an important part of the game. Keep practicing it whenever possible, it also helps to move quickly. The pointer you see has multiple uses in melee just move your character close so that he faces the enemy or thing you want to destroy and use your pointer to direct kid to the direction of the enemy. In ranged hold the click and you can see arrows pointing, align these arrows to your target and release the click, rely on the mouse pointer to point to any thing in ranged combat. =============================================================================== 4.2.POWERSHOT {POW1} Extremely useful as it deals extra damage, and instead of firing twice at an enemy, only do it once. To get the powershot you have to time the weapon properly, it is only available for projectile weapons. To fire these weapons you have to hold the click for a certain time, as you hold the click kid will flash at a time during the duration of your hold, and the powershot only comes just before kid enters this flash state. So in a sense you have to hold and release the click just as the kid enters the flashing state, the only way to get this is to get used to the time, you can practice this in the proving grounds. More on this later in the proving grounds section. =============================================================================== 4.3.SHIELD {SHLD1} You will have access to the shield from almost the very beginning of the game. Use the button for DEFEND to invoke the shield. The shield protects you from all damage from the side the shield faces, but you are vulnerable from all other sides. The use of shield is automated; Every time you use defend, the shield will automatically point towards the nearest opponent, only protecting you from it. In all of the game, there will be multiple enemies from all sides hence the use of shield is quite complex, and you have to be quick about it. The shield is also used for auto-aim, when you hold the button for the shield, as mentioned earlier the shield automatically points to an enemy, just hold the button for shield and go about attack the enemy, this is of tremendous use. The shield can be used for COUTER-ATTACK. For this simply press the defend button just before the opponents attacks reach you or hit you, and it is slightly more tougher using counter for melee opponents, because each melee opponent has a different way of attacking which you have to watch closely and hit defend just before it lays the attack on you. At the end of the day, counter attacking can be achieved properly only by practice and your intuition. For practicing counterattacking and using shield you will have an arena. more on this in the proving grounds section... =============================================================================== 4.4.BUILDING BASTION {BB1} The primary purpose of the game is to restore the BASTION to it's full glory as it has been destroyed due to a recent calamity. The whole premise of the game is set in the aftermath of this catastrophe. You can build new buildings in the BASTION by adding new cores. Cores are central to all building in BASTION, they can be found on different places in the map. When you click on a particular place, the map will tell you if it has a core or not. And well! the map can't always be right, only one way to find out ain't it? Later on you will also need to collect shards but if I reveal more it's gonna be a spoiler, you'll find out eventually what these are for... The following is a comprehensive list of buildings in the BASTION. /-------------------\ | DISTILLERY | \-------------------/ As you level up, for every level you can equip a spirit in the distillery which provide extra bonuses or powers which are always active. When you upgrade the distillery you can get a hold of more spirits. /-------------------\ | ARSENAL | \-------------------/ When you need to assign a weapon the a particular mouse button or choose between various weapons to assigning this is where you go. Also you can select the special skills here. /-------------------\ | FORGE | \-------------------/ You fine many "something" in the game. This is the place to use them to upgrade your weapons. Each item is used for a different weapon. When the forge is upgraded, you will have 5 upgrade slots for each weapon instead of three. /-------------------\ | LOST-AND-FOUND | \-------------------/ This place is a store of sorts. You can buy many things that have been long lost in the world around you. You will need fragments as they are what remain of the old world and they are used to create the items you wish for. You can buy upgrades, idols, spirits and special skills here. Visit often to see what new items are in store. /-------------------\ | SHRINE | \-------------------/ The shrine is a place for the fickle Gods of Bastion. Each god has a certain effect on your enemies and when activated, there will be a bonus on the XP and number fragments in the game. GODs Hense Acobi Lemaign Pyth Jevel Yudrig Roathus Micia Olak Garmuth /-------------------\ | MEMORIAL | \-------------------/ it's a place to honor the dead and gone. Memorials come to life when you obtain a new weapon and some of the vigils here are already unlocked. Complete these vigils and earn extra fragments. =============================================================================== 4.5.FRAGMENTS {FRG1} They are the remnants of the old world and you need to collect as many as possible as they can be recreated to something in the present world. Pick up the breakers bow and line up so that you can hit three balls with one shot, if you can make proper powershots, you can take out three at a time shooting diagonally and the last one, so it can be done in a total of five shots minimum for 1st prize, second is 5-10 and third is above 10 shots. You will need those prizes so keep practicing and the perfect score of five is extremely hard to get now, so just settle for second place and go back to the bastion. You can restart the proving ground by moving to the left and hitting the use button near the switch. You can always come back to this pace unlike the island containing cores which you can only play once. You can't find use of the prizes just yet so just move on if you want to. First Prize - Breaker Volley. _______________________________________________________________________________ [--TRAPPER SHINGLE--] Proving Ground {PGTS} Fang Repeater =============================================================================== A challenging one, you got to shoot the blue spike balls as you move avoiding a fall. There is only limited amount of balls here (64). You must not miss any if you want the first prize and if you miss and the path falls off, you can't come back. Just be quick and you will do fine. One tip is that shoot when you have ammo standing in one place as many as you can, and when it's time to reload use evade to move forward and after reload is done start again. Third - 24 balls Second - 48 balls First - 64 balls First Prize - Snooze Dart _______________________________________________________________________________ [--WINDBAG RANCH--] Proving Ground {PGWR} War Machete. =============================================================================== Nothing much to this except to tell you to finish it as fast as possible, the best way to do this is when you begin stand in the central place from which the squirts start coming from the ground and keep slashing, when that is done concentrate on the shooters, be careful as they take some damage and shrink to make you think they are dead but keep hitting them till they disappear totally, head to the cornbins and take em out and finally kill what's left. whoo,,, The green ones are hard to hit and may need a throw of the machete, this is where you will lose time - hitting the green ones. Walk down the log bridge, pick up your pistols and when a dummy randomly falls on a side, start shooting. The trick here is that you need to hold shift as soon as you see a dummy fall down and start mashin'; don't bother aiming with the mouse, you don't need to aim, just hold shift as soon as you see it and shoot it, in fact after the first dummy, don't even bother releasing shift, just hold it for the rest of your challenge but only shoot after you see a dummy. You may want to upgrade your pistol a bit before you can win first prize but the rest are easy pickings. Third less than 500 Second 500-700 First more than 700 First Prize - SLINGER STORM _______________________________________________________________________________ [--CAMP DAUNCY--] Proving Ground {PGCD} Brusher's Pike =============================================================================== This many look really difficult the first few times around, but it can get real easy after a few tries. In this area are 6 switches, you need to activate them as soon as possible. The trick here is to destroy only those pincushions which block your path to the switch, killing others will simply waste your time. Start the course from your left, then go to your right, then up left, then up right, then down and down again. Going this way will save you some time. [4] [3] [5] [2] [1] [6] {} - start That is the order which you can go. Going that way also saves you considerable amount of time destroying the pikes. Another handy tip is that first, when you click the mouse you make a hit, now don't release your mouse, hold it and throw at you next target, so click-hold click-hold don't keep clicking, also throwing lets you destroy upto three cushions, so you can save a hell load of time using what I mentioned. Also before coming to this area equip the hearty punch tonic which gives you an extra chance after you die, now when there aren't too any cushions shooting at you or if there is only one shooting at you just pass thru it instead of killing it, this can save a lot of time too. Finally, along the first few tries don't rush through the areas, just take your time and see the shortest way to the switches. Go take the skyway back to Bastion and take the skyway here again to...
